Setting
Can be set when "Dynamic Volume" is set to "ON".
Set Dynamic Volume effect.
[Selectable items]
Midnight
: High setting affects volume the most, causing all sounds
to be of equal loudness.
Evening
: Middle setting prevents loud and soft sounds from
being much louder and softer respectively than average
sounds.
Day
: Low setting provides the least adjustments to the
loudest and softest of sounds.

About Dynamic EQ
Audyssey Dynamic EQ™ solves the problem of deteriorating sound
quality as volume is decreased by taking into account human
perception and room acoustics.
Dynamic EQ selects the correct frequency response and surround
levels moment-by-moment at any user-selected volume setting. The
result is bass response, tonal balance, and surround impression that
remain constant despite changes in volume. Dynamic EQ combines
information from incoming source levels with actual output sound
levels in the room, a prerequisite for delivering a loudness correction
solution.

About Dynamic Volume
Audyssey Dynamic Volume™ solves the problem of large variations
in volume level between television programs, commercials, and
between the soft and loud passages of movies.
Dynamic Volume looks at the preferred volume setting by the user
and then monitors how the volume of program material is being
perceived by listeners in real time to decide whether an adjustment
is needed. Whenever necessary, Dynamic Volume makes the
necessary rapid or gradual adjustments to maintain the desired
playback volume level while optimizing the dynamic range.
Audyssey Dynamic EQ is integrated into Dynamic Volume so that
as the playback volume is adjusted automatically, the perceived
bass response, tonal balance, surround impression, and dialog
clarity remain the same whether watching movies, flipping between
television channels, or changing from stereo to surround sound
content.
